Yellowstone’s Hassie Harrison Takes On Pamela Anderson’s Baywatch Role

Hassie Harrison, known for her role in Yellowstone, has taken on a part in the new Baywatch reboot alongside Stephen Amell. The revival series, set to air this September on Fox, features Harrison as Nat, a character once made famous by Pamela Anderson.

Nat is described as

“a former foster kid turned Olympic athlete who is the gold standard when it comes to lifeguarding.”

As the closest friend and right hand to Hobie Buchannon, played by Amell, Nat’s high expectations place challenges on her relationships both on and off duty.

“Brilliant, driven, and fiercely loyal, she’s the right hand and closest friend of protagonist Hobie Buchannon (Stephen Amell), Nat holds everyone to the same high standards she has for herself, which sometimes gets in the way of her relationships on and off the beach.”

Legacy of Pamela Anderson’s Iconic Baywatch Character

Pamela Anderson earned worldwide recognition as CJ Parker in the original Baywatch series from the 1990s. CJ Parker was a lifeguard celebrated for her vibrant persona, courage, and dedication.

She was among the most skilled lifeguards and served as a trusted confidante to Mitch Buchannon, portrayed by David Hasselhoff, whom she viewed as a father figure.

Hassie Harrison’s Rise and Personal Life

Before her Baywatch role, Hassie Harrison gained fame playing Laramie on Yellowstone. During filming, she met Ryan Bingham, who portrayed her on-screen love interest, Walker. The couple tied the knot in 2024 at Harrison’s family residence in Dallas, Texas, about a year after publicly confirming their relationship.

Harrison shared details of their wedding theme, emphasizing a sophisticated Western style with

“tones of worn leather, delicate lace, and a soft, blush color palette.”

She described the experience as a true reflection of their personalities and a remarkable moment for both.

Plot and New Characters in the Baywatch Revival

The reboot centers on Hobie Buchannon, the son of Mitch Buchannon, continuing the family’s lifeguard legacy. The storyline begins when Charlie, Hobie’s previously unknown daughter from Galveston, Texas, arrives, determined to carry on the Buchannon tradition.

Charlie is portrayed as fearless and passionate but sometimes reckless, embodying the qualities associated with the Buchannon name while needing guidance from her father.

“Fearless, passionate, and occasionally reckless, Charlie has all the makings of a Buchannon legend. She has a lot to learn, however, and the father she never met might be exactly the mentor she’s always needed,”

the character description states.

Jessica Belkin takes on the role of Charlie, with Thaddeus LaGrone joining as series regular Brad. David Chokachi returns as Cody Madison, reprising his original role.

Baywatch’s Enduring Cultural Impact and Revival Details

Since its debut in 1989, Baywatch has become synonymous with vibrant red swimsuits, dramatic slow-motion beach runs, and an ensemble of attractive lifeguards tackling both heroic rescues and personal dilemmas. The show captivated over a billion viewers worldwide and launched the careers of stars like Pamela Anderson and David Hasselhoff.

Baywatch’s lasting cultural influence has spawned multiple spin-offs and a 2017 reboot film starring Dwayne Johnson and Zac Efron. The upcoming 2026 series promises to revive its trademark elements while introducing a fresh generation of lifeguards facing complex personal challenges.

“Daring ocean rescues, pristine beaches, and iconic red bathing suits are back, along with a whole new generation of Baywatch lifeguards, who navigate complicated, messy personal lives in this action-packed reboot that demonstrates there’s the family you’re born into and the family you find,”

the show’s logline explains.
